You Won’t Believe That These Avocado Nachos Are 100% Vegan

avocado nachos

Plant-based food has come a long way in recent years. With the rise of the “bleeding” Impossible Burger and a plethora of plant-based substitutes available in grocery stores, it’s now incredibly easy to make vegan food indulgent. These avocado nachos are proof that comfort vegan food can truly flourish.

Created by vegan restaurant Butterleaf, the dish consists of crispy pieces of avocado coated in a warm cashew cheese sauce. Between the crunch of the avocado and the warm, melty flavors of the cashew cheese, you’ll be hard pressed to differentiate between these and actual nachos.
